Vitaminology Company

CARRBORO, N.C., Feb. 1 /PRNewswire/ -- BioMachines Inc., a biotech company that sells advanced automation tools to accelerate drug discovery, today announced that a majority stake in the business was acquired by Clearview Limited. With this transaction comes two new leaders and a focus on expanding commercialization of the company's technology ...

Industry: Longevity & Wellness
Headquarters: London, Greater London, United Kingdom